Conveyancer (paralegal) faces medium automation risk: AI can handle document review and template generation, but client communication, liability, and complex case law still rely on human judgment. Entry-level roles shrink slightly due to legal process digitization, but experienced practitioners can leverage AI tools to amplify efficiency.

⚠ Tasks AI will take over or replace
  • Automatic generation and preliminary review of property document templates.
  • Rule-based due diligence checklist checking
  • Automatic reminders and tracking of appointments and deadlines
  • Standardized document filling for real estate transaction processes
  • Simple proofreading and formatting of legal documents
↑ Tasks AI will augment
  • AI-Assisted Complex Title Search & Title Chain Visualization
  • Smart contract management systems improve efficiency in handling multiple cases
  • Automated generation of client progress reports and risk alerts
  • Use NLP to quickly extract key clauses and potential conflicts
  • Chatbots handle routine customer inquiries, freeing up time
🛡 Human moat
  • Legal strategy and judgment in complex property disputes
  • High-sensitivity communication with clients, banks, municipalities, etc.
  • Professional reasoning on incomplete information or conflicting clues
  • Assume sign-off responsibility and occupational risk management
  • In-depth interpretation of local regulations and location-specific advice
Skills to build (next 5 years)
  • Hands-on experience with LegalTech tools (e.g., Clio, PracticePanther)
  • Use of AI-assisted document review platforms (e.g., Kira, Relativity)
  • Data analysis and statistics related to property rights.
  • Advanced search and information verification techniques
  • Project management and client communication skills
  • Basic programming (Python/API) to customize automated workflows
Entry-level outlook

Entry-level tasks like document review and basic research are taken over by AI, reducing entry opportunities; but AI tools lower document processing thresholds, some roles transform into AI-assisted positions, overall slightly narrower.

🚀 How to level up in the AI era

Shift from basic document processing to 'Legal Process Analyst' or 'AI Legal Operations Specialist': use AI tools to optimize property transfer process efficiency, while strengthening negotiation and client trust. Also extend to regtech or specialized legal consulting, providing predictive property risk analysis with data insights.

Career outlook

Can progress from junior legal assistant to senior legal assistant, case manager, or legal administrative supervisor. Some become lawyers through further study. Specialization in areas such as immigration law or property law offers more opportunities.

Canada's legal services sector continues to grow, with stable demand for paralegals. Regulated occupation in Ontario, job opportunities concentrated in law firms, government, and corporate legal departments.

FAQ

What is the salary level for paralegals in Canada?
Entry-level about CAD 38,000-48,000, mid-level CAD 48,000-65,000, senior up to CAD 85,000. Salaries are higher in Ontario and big law firms.
How can a paralegal immigrate to Canada?
Eligible via Federal Express Entry (FSW/CEC) or Provincial Nominee Program (PNP). Requires education credential assessment, language test results, and work experience. Ontario paralegals are regulated and require additional certification.
